Regulation of plasma triglycerides in insulin resistance and diabetes

HN Ginsberg, YL Zhang, A Hernandez-Ono - Archives of medical research, 2005 - Elsevier
Increased plasma levels of triglycerides (TG) in very low density lipoproteins (VLDL) are not
only common characteristics of the dyslipidemia associated with insulin resistance and type
2 diabetes mellitus (T2DM) but are the central pathophysiologic feature of the abnormal lipid
profile. Overproduction of VLDL leads to increased plasma levels of TG which, via an
exchange process mediated by cholesterol ester transfer protein (CETP), results in low
